Current Employee3.1Jan 27, 2024big reliance on legacy products, little desire to change. experience depends on team
Current Employee2.4Jun 27, 2023It’s ok. The lack of diversity is pretty insane but in comparison they are pretty competitive with their comp packages. Leadership really depends on who you get. Could be good, could be awful. Same goes for your territory. Biggest challenge of selling is all the internal bullsh*t which needs to change asap.
It’s ok. The lack of diversity is pretty insane but in comparison they are pretty competitive with their comp packages. Leadership really depends on who you get. Could be good, could be awful. Same goes for your territory. Biggest challenge of selling is all the internal bullsh*t which needs to change asap.
Former Employee3.7Oct 21, 2024For a sdr role it's good, but the salary is a little bit below the average in EMEA.